MAXSUS BEMOR GURUHLARI (QANDLI DIABET, HOMILADORLIK)

Abstract

Mazkur maqolada terapevtik stomatologiya amaliyotida maxsus bemor guruhlari hisoblangan qandli diabet bilan og‘rigan bemorlar hamda homilador ayollarda stomatologik kasalliklarning kechish xususiyatlari tahlil qilinadi. Ushbu bemorlarda og‘iz bo‘shlig‘i kasalliklarining rivojlanishi, klinik belgilari va davolash jarayonidagi muhim jihatlar yoritilgan. Qandli diabet holatida to‘qimalarning tiklanish qobiliyati pasayishi va yallig‘lanish jarayonlarining uzoq davom etishi, homiladorlik davrida esa gormonal o‘zgarishlar ta’sirida gingivit va kariyes xavfining ortishi asoslab berilgan. Maqolada terapevtik stomatologik muolajalarni individual rejalashtirish, yumshoq davolash usullarini qo‘llash hamda profilaktik choralarni kuchaytirish zarurligi ta’kidlanadi. Keltirilgan tahlillar maxsus bemor guruhlarida stomatologik yordam ko‘rsatish samaradorligini oshirishga xizmat qiladi.
